Population & Demographics

The following information lists the population statistics and breakdown for the 74633 zip code. The total population is 667, of which, 374 are male and 293 are female. With a total area of 247.778 square miles, the population density is 1.8 people per square mile. The median age of the population is 23.4 years old. Income & Economic Characteristics

The median inflation-adjusted family income in the 74633 zip code is $60625. This is 37.93% greater than the national average. This income places 8.8% of the population below the poverty line. The average retirement income for individuals in this zip code (for those that have it) is $13065. Education

In the 74633 zip code, 84.4% of individuals over 25 years old have a high school degree or higher, and 18.3% have a bachelors degree or higher. Occupation and Work Characteristics

In the 74633 zip, there are an estimated 183 people in the labor force, of which, 175 are employed, and 8 are unemployed. There are a total of 0 people in the armed forces. The average commute time for this zip code is 27.2 minutes. Of the total people that work, 3 worked from home and 172 commuted. The average number of hours worked is 38.6. Housing

The median home value for the 74633 zip code is 108500. There is an estimated  151 number of occupied housing units, the median gross rent in is $613 per month, and the average monthly housing costs are estimated to be $763.
